Early intervention in Rockville

For children under three, contact Montgomery County's Infants and Toddlers Program through your pediatrician. When your child turns three, we take it from there.

The Maryland Autism Waiver

The Autism Waiver funds additional support beyond standard Medicaid. The waitlist is long. Call (866) 417-3480 to register as soon as possible.

Rockville autism resources

Worth bookmarking.

xMinds

Rockville-based organization focused on improving educational outcomes for autistic students in MCPS. Parent discussion groups and a comprehensive MCPS program guide.

(301) 444-5225

The Arc Montgomery County

IEP workshops through their Tools for School program, family advocacy, and resource navigation.

(301) 984-5777

Treatment and Learning Centers

Rockville-based evaluation, therapy, and family support for children with autism and developmental disabilities.

Partnership for Extraordinary Minds

Montgomery County's leading autism advocacy organization. Workshops and resources for families.
